This news from late 2021 apparently.
The London-based music streaming platform formerly known as MelodyVR on Thursday said that since its reverse takeover of the Napster business in December of last year, its employees, consumers and other stakeholders now are predominantly in the US, with 42% of revenue generated in North America.
Napster has created Delaware-incorporated NM to buy Rhapsody, the subsidiary that holds almost all of its assets and liabilities, for USD45.6 million.
Existing shareholders will receive one NM share for each Napster share they hold following a 750-into-1 share consolidation.
morning ripley.basically the old napster shares(after the 750 for 1 consolidation)were converted under a scheme of arrangement into shares in napster Music inc,a private delaware incorporated company.in febuary a consortium comprising algorand and others led an agreed buyout of Napster Music and the shareholders in napster music became entitled to various stage payments. if you read through the posts on here(there aren't that many)you will see the payments described,including the final consideration which will,apparently,be paid in cash if the napster tokens described in the posts etc,are not launched by the 31st march.if the tokens are launched(whatever that actually means) by 31st then shareholders will get tokens(a form of NFT designed for use in the napster web3 system and associated operations) instead. it's starting to look a little late to get the tokens launched,although still possible i suppose. the posts on here will flesh this outline out and provided details of the cash payments etc.posts by highland on 9/6/22, horsesgob on30/6/22 and glenstar on 6/10/22 are very helpful.to get a definitive statement of the position as it relates to you personally.obviously you will need to discuss with your broker or platform provider as appropriate.you should have received the initial cash payment by now .

hello ripley. yes, you should have received a payment of approx 6.06 usd per share (that's post consolidation).some posters only received payment fairly recently, although i,and many other posters, got theirs many months ago.brokers/platform providers have dealt with the receipt of payments in varying ways resulting in the disparity of receipt dates.i suggest you check with your broker etc to see if you have had it.the next two payments will be due after the 31st march and should total about 1 usd per share(less some as yet unknown deductions).if the tokens are not issued by 31st march then in principle the final payment will be about 5.5 usd per share i believe.
